  • Is the GPU-CPU rendering combination slower than just GPU rendering?

    The GPU-CPU rendering combination can be slower than just GPU rendering in some cases. This is because the CPU may not be as efficient at handling rendering tasks as the GPU, which is specifically designed for graphics processing. However, in certain scenarios, such as when the CPU is able to handle certain aspects of the rendering process more effectively than the GPU, the combination of both can result in faster overall rendering times. Ultimately, the speed of the GPU-CPU rendering combination will depend on the specific hardware and software being used, as well as the nature of the rendering task.

  • What is the rendering quality?

    Rendering quality refers to the level of detail, clarity, and realism in the final output of a digital image or video. It is determined by factors such as resolution, texture, lighting, shading, and overall visual fidelity. Higher rendering quality results in more lifelike and visually appealing images, while lower rendering quality may appear pixelated, blurry, or lacking in detail. Achieving high rendering quality often requires more computational power and resources to accurately simulate the visual elements of the scene.

  • What is used during rendering?

    During rendering, a computer program uses the data stored in a 3D model to generate 2D images or animations. This process involves calculating the lighting, shadows, textures, and other visual effects to create a realistic representation of the scene. Rendering also utilizes the computer's graphics processing unit (GPU) to perform complex calculations quickly and efficiently. The final output of the rendering process is a visual representation of the 3D model that can be viewed on a screen or in a digital format.

  • What does "template rendering" mean?

    Template rendering refers to the process of generating a final output by combining a template with data. In web development, this often involves using a template engine to insert dynamic content into a pre-designed template, resulting in a fully rendered web page. The template contains the structure and layout of the page, while the data provides the specific content to be displayed. This process allows for efficient and consistent generation of web pages with dynamic content.
